Dread 1 is now complete!

Although this now fills me with dread for doing the second one as it took a while to do!

Decided to do something a little special for his heraldry, hence the freehanded icon on his shin pad. Its meant to be a phoenix, which i thought was appropriate for a dread to signify him rising from death to fight on for the emperor. I think the freehand looks ok, certainly not something i'm going to do on every model, need to think of a second device for the other dread now.











Happy with how he looks, now just need to pluck up the willpower to start the second one.
